S. John Crowley: A Journey Through Art and Service

From the crucible of early trials to the disciplined ranks of the U.S. Army, S. John Crowley’s life is a canvas of resilience and transformation. Orphaned at fourteen and later embracing the call of duty as an Armor Crewman during the Cold War, his four-year military service honed a spirit that would imbue his art with profound depth.

Post-service, 1996 marked Crowley’s odyssey into the scenic arts in Hollywood, California, where under the mentorship of industry stalwarts like Frank Pera and Bill Anderson, he mastered his craft. At Walt Disney Imagineering, he painted dreams into reality, contributing to the enchanting worlds of the Disney Stores, the Disney Cruise Line, Tokyo Disney, and Tomorrow Land.

His artistry further flourished at NBC’s “Passions” and the Oscars, showcasing his versatility and commitment to scenic excellence. Yet, the call of duty echoed again, and Crowley answered, serving with valor in Operation Iraqi Freedom earning a Combat Action Badge. It was an experience that intensified the narratives woven into his artworks.

S. John Crowley Former Member of The Local 816

Scenic, Title and Graphic Artists Local 816 was a professional association of artists that had special skills and talents within the entertainment industry. Local 816 represented members that worked in many diverse, but related fields of the entertainment industry, such as: Motion Picture, Television, Theater, Theme Amusement Parks, Commercials, Independent Scene Shops, Trade Shows and Museums.

On July 1st, 2003, the Local 816 merged with the Art Directors Guild, I.A.T.S.E. Local 876 and formed the new I.A.T.S.E., Local 850, Art Directors Guild and Scenic, Graphic and Title Artists Local. – Source: Wikipedia
